Overview:

Under the supervision and direction of a Registered Nurse, the behavioral health patient safety attendant will provide care to a patient by sitting with and diligently watching the patient while meeting the established criteria in accordance with established methods and procedures of the Medical Center.

Responsibilities:
  • Maintain continuous visual observation of assigned patients to ensure a safe and secure environment at all times.
  • Monitor and report changes in patient behavior, mental status, condition, or activities to the Registered Nurse (RN) immediately.
  • Adhere to all patient safety protocols, including Close Observation and Suicidal Patient Monitoring procedures.
  • Maintain a clean, safe, and organized patient environment, reporting maintenance or safety concerns promptly.
  • Follow infection prevention and control practices, including universal precautions.
  • Accurately document patient observations and activities on required monitoring records and observation logs.
  • Provide clear and accurate shift-to-shift reports, communicating patient status, observations, and changes in care plans.
  • Use verbal redirection and approved de-escalation techniques to support patient safety and manage challenging behaviors.
  • Establish and maintain appropriate professional boundaries while interacting with patients.
  • Provide patients with routine explanations regarding care and activities while refraining from counseling or offering personal opinions.
  • Immediately notify nursing staff when patient assistance or intervention is required.
  • Escort patients to diagnostic tests, procedures, therapeutic activities, and other scheduled appointments as needed.
  • Demonstrate focused attention on patient observation duties, minimizing distractions and maintaining vigilance throughout the shift.
  • Uphold organizational values and standards of professionalism, compassion, respect, and patient-centered care.
  • Collaborate effectively with nursing staff and other healthcare team members to support quality patient care.
  • Perform additional duties and responsibilities as assigned.
